16th July 2025, Bhubaneswar:: 16 gates of the Hirakud Reservoir have been opened. Floodwater is currently being discharged through these 16 gates. On the left side of the Hirakud Dam, 11 gates have been opened. On the right side, water is being released through 5 gates. The current water level of Hirakud Reservoir is 605.39 feet. Inflow of water is 2,41,252 cusecs per second. Outflow of water is 2,68,469 cusecs per second. Of this, 2,31,664 cusecs of water is being released through the spillway. 33,570 cusecs of water is being released through the power channel. The Hirakud Dam has a total of 98 gates, including 64 sluice gates and 34 crest gates. The maximum water storage capacity of Hirakud Dam is 630 feet.
